What are the best strategies to move into leadership roles in tech?

5 min
52
0
0
Published on

The tech industry is an exciting, fast-moving world filled with opportunities for innovation and growth. Whether you’re a software developer, data analyst, or IT contractor, there comes a point where you might ask yourself, What’s next? For many, the natural answer is to move into leadership roles.

But making the leap from a technical role to leadership isn’t just about being the best at what you do—it requires a shift in mindset, skills, and approach. Whether you’re a permanent employee looking to climb the corporate ladder or a contractor considering team-lead projects, these strategies will help you navigate the path to leadership in tech.

1. Understand what leadership in tech entails

Leadership roles in tech aren’t just about managing people; they involve:

  • Driving projects to success.

  • Aligning technical goals with business strategies.

  • Communicating effectively with technical and non-technical stakeholders.

  • Mentoring and inspiring your team.

Take time to reflect on why you want to lead. Are you passionate about empowering others? Do you want to influence larger business decisions? Understanding your "why" will shape your approach.

2. Develop leadership qualities early

Leadership is more than a title—it's about how you operate, even before you’re officially in charge. Start by:

  • Taking initiative: Volunteer for projects where you can solve problems, guide others, or propose new ideas.

  • Building trust: Deliver on your promises, communicate openly, and be a team player.

  • Showing empathy: Understand your teammates’ challenges and support them where possible.

The best leaders are those who naturally inspire confidence and collaboration long before they’re given formal authority

3. Build soft skills alongside technical expertise

While technical excellence is essential in tech roles, leadership requires mastering soft skills:

  • Communication: Learn how to explain complex ideas in simple terms. This skill is critical when working with executives or clients who may not have a technical background.

  • Emotional intelligence: Understand how to manage your emotions and empathize with others. This helps with conflict resolution and team morale.

  • Decision-making: Hone your ability to make well-informed decisions under pressure.

Invest in courses or workshops on leadership and communication. Online platforms like LinkedIn Learning and Coursera offer excellent resources tailored for tech professionals.

4. Seek out leadership opportunities in your current role

Leadership opportunities don’t always come with a formal title. Start by finding ways to take on leadership responsibilities within your current role:

  • Mentor junior team members: Sharing your expertise and guiding others shows that you’re capable of leading.

  • Lead small projects: Volunteer to manage specific tasks or projects, even if it’s outside your job description.

  • Take ownership: If you see an inefficiency or opportunity for improvement, step up and propose a solution.

These experiences allow you to demonstrate leadership qualities while building confidence in your abilities.

5. Learn the business side of tech

To be a successful leader, you need to understand how technical projects align with broader business goals. Focus on:

  • Financial acumen: Learn about budgets, ROI, and how technical projects impact profitability.

  • Strategic thinking: Understand how emerging technologies can solve business challenges.

  • Stakeholder management: Learn how to communicate with executives, clients, and other departments.

Consider taking a course on business strategy or attending workshops that teach the intersection of tech and business.

6. Build your personal brand

Leadership roles often go to those who are visible and respected in their field. Building your personal brand can help position you as a go-to expert and future leader:

  • Network actively: Attend tech meetups, webinars, and conferences to connect with industry peers and leaders.

  • Share knowledge: Write articles, give talks, or contribute to open-source projects to showcase your expertise.

  • Optimise your LinkedIn profile: Highlight leadership qualities, projects you’ve led, and testimonials from colleagues.

Building a strong professional presence ensures that when leadership opportunities arise, your name comes to mind.

7. Upskill for leadership roles

The tech landscape evolves quickly, and leadership roles often require a broader skill set. Consider:

  • Technical skills: Stay current with the latest tools, programming languages, or methodologies relevant to your field.

  • Management training: Enroll in courses on project management (e.g., PRINCE2, Agile) or leadership coaching.

  • Certifications: Certifications like AWS Solutions Architect, ITIL, or PMP not only boost your technical credibility but also showcase your readiness for higher responsibilities.

Continuous learning shows your commitment to growth, a trait highly valued in leaders.

8. Understand different leadership pathways

Not all leadership roles in tech are the same. Choose a pathway that aligns with your interests and skills:

  • Technical leadership: Roles like Lead Developer or Solutions Architect, where you oversee technical decisions and mentor others while staying hands-on.

  • Managerial leadership: Roles like IT Manager or Project Manager, focusing on team management, resource allocation, and aligning with business goals.

  • Strategic leadership: Roles like CTO or Head of IT, where you shape the company’s technology strategy and lead large teams.

Each pathway requires a different set of skills, so tailor your development accordingly.

9. Learn from current leaders

Seek mentorship from those already in leadership positions. They can provide invaluable insights, feedback, and guidance on navigating your career.

  • Ask questions: Find out how they transitioned into leadership, what challenges they faced, and what skills they find most important.

  • Observe: Pay attention to how they handle conflicts, make decisions, and motivate their teams.

  • Request feedback: Ask for constructive feedback on your readiness for leadership and areas for improvement.

Many leaders are more than willing to share their knowledge if you show genuine interest.

10. Be open to contract or interim leadership roles

If you’re a contractor or freelancer, leadership opportunities may come in the form of interim roles, such as leading a team for a specific project. These roles allow you to:

  • Gain hands-on leadership experience.

  • Showcase your ability to deliver results in high-pressure environments.

  • Build a track record that can open doors to permanent leadership roles.

Being a contractor doesn’t mean you can’t aim for leadership—it simply requires a slightly different approach.

11. Prepare for challenges

Leadership comes with its own set of challenges, including:

  • Balancing team needs with business goals: Learning to manage diverse priorities.

  • Managing difficult conversations: Addressing performance issues or conflicts diplomatically.

  • Staying adaptable: Being open to change and continuous learning.

Understanding and preparing for these challenges will help you navigate the transition smoothly.

12. Take the leap when the opportunity comes

Finally, when a leadership opportunity arises, don’t hesitate to take it—even if it feels intimidating. Imposter syndrome is common when stepping into new roles, but remember:

  • You’ve built the skills.

  • You’ve demonstrated leadership qualities.

  • You’re ready for the challenge.

Trust your abilities and know that every leader starts somewhere.

Moving into leadership roles in tech is about more than just climbing the career ladder—it’s about making an impact, driving innovation, and inspiring others. By combining technical expertise with strong leadership qualities, understanding the business side of tech, and seizing opportunities for growth, you can position yourself as a standout candidate for leadership.

Whether you’re a permanent employee eyeing a managerial role or a contractor stepping up to lead a team, the strategies outlined above will help you take your career to the next level. So start building your leadership journey today—you’ve got this!

Continue reading around the topics :

Comment

In the same category

top it jobs IT Career Advice
Whether you're a seasoned professional or just starting your career, understanding the most in-demand jobs in the tech industry can help you stay competitive in the IT & tech job market.
5 min

Connecting Tech-Talent

Free-Work, THE platform for all IT professionals.

Free-workers
Resources
About
Recruiters area
2024 © Free-Work / AGSI SAS
Follow us